Transaction 51585407828b906b4a1d174887c69924e2978632d9a2fb2ef23d545ef026e6c6
1 Input
1 Output
-
51585407828b906b4a1d174887c69924e2978632d9a2fb2ef23d545ef026e6c6:0
- value
- 16125795
- script pubkey
- OP_0 OP_PUSHBYTES_20 356302f93fbe811339840c6adcaabd64c541ee13
- address
- bc1qx43s97flh6q3xwvyp34de24avnz5rmsn4cukfj